Abstract

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engevaluasi penyerapan kompetensi siswa di SMK Swasta Pembda Nias pada mata pelajaran produktif menggunakan metode penilaian otentik. Penilaian otentik diterapkan untuk mengukur sejauh mana siswa menguasai kompetensi yang relevan dengan kebutuhan industri. Metode penelitian yang digunakan adalah penelitian deskriptif dengan pendekatan kualitatif, dimana data dikumpulkan melalui observasi, wawancara, dan dokumentasi.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a metode penilaian otentik membantu siswa dalam memahami aplikasi praktis dari teori yang diajarkan, namun terdapat beberapa tantangan dalam implementasi, seperti keterbatasan sarana dan prasarana. Rekomendasi dari penelitian ini mencakup perlunya peningkatan kapasitas guru dalam merancang penilaian otentik yang lebih efektif serta pemenuhan fasilitas yang mendukung kegiatan belajar praktik.

Abstract

The Triple Elimination program aims to prevent vertical transmission of HIV, syphilis, and hepatitis B from mother to child through the integration of routine screening in antenatal care (ANC) services. This program is in line with WHO's global commitment to eliminate the transmission of infectious diseases from mother to child that has the potential to have a long-term impact on infant health. The implementation of this program in primary service facilities such as health centers has a strategic role in improving early detection and proper management. This study aims to analyze the effect of program implementation on the quality of ANC services in Puskesmas. Using a quantitative approach with a cross-sectional design, the study involved 88 pregnant women as respondents. Data was obtained through a structured questionnaire that measured maternal satisfaction with aspects of services, such as accessibility, communication, physical examination, and information provided by health workers. Data analysis was performed by Chi-Square test, and the results showed a significant relationship between the implementation of the Triple Elimination program and the perception of ANC service quality (p = 0.013; OR = 2.7; 95% CI: 1.3–5.5). These results show that pregnant women who receive complete screening tend to be more satisfied with ANC services, because they feel comprehensively served. The implementation of Triple Elimination has a positive impact not only in the medical aspect but also in the psychological and emotional aspect, as it provides a sense of security against the potential transmission of serious diseases to the fetus. Suggestions are needed to strengthen the implementation of the program through improving laboratory infrastructure, the availability of reagents and logistics, continuous coaching for health workers, and intensive counseling to the community, so that the scope of the program is wider and more even. Cross-sector synergy and strong policy support are also key to the success of the program's sustainability

Abstract

A simple and secure security accounting system is a system needed by various large and small companies where of course the company is never separated from accounting in order to process financial expenditures and revenues owned by companies that have a purpose to make a profit. Efforts to achieve success in a company can be seen from financial management which can be monitored and can be managed properly so that finance can be controlled well too, for that accuracy is an important role so with the company's cloud accounting it can be easier to monitor and also manage financial well, so it will be easier to make income / loss statements. cloud accounting provides a user friendly look that can certainly facilitate users. The purpose of this study is so that companies can pay more attention to monitoring and managing finances well so that it can facilitate the making of income statement . In this study took place used observational research methods and field library studies so that the system made can meet the existing needs of the company.
